How they compare
Republic of Korea currently reports 11,902 per 1 million people against 11,720 per 1 million people in Saint Kitts and Nevis, a difference of 182 per 1 million people.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 15 shared years of data; in 2010 it was Saint Kitts and Nevis ahead.
Republic of Korea ranks 56th and Saint Kitts and Nevis ranks 57th of 215 countries.
Saint Kitts and Nevis has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

About this data
The number of distinct, publicly-trusted TLS/SSL certificates found in the Netcraft Secure Server Survey (by hosting country), per 1 million people.
